1. Department of Medical Surgical Nursing, College of Nursing, University of Hail, Hail, Saudi Arabia
2. Department of Nursing, Faculty of Medicine and Health Sciences, Taiz University, Taiz, Yemen
3. Department of Science and Technology, University College-Ranyah, Taif University, Taif, Saudi Arabia
4. Department of Chemistry, College of Science, Taif University, Taif, Saudi Arabia
5. Department of Nursing, Faculty of Medicine and Health Sciences, Hodeida University, Hodeida, Yemen
6. Department of Nursing, Faculty of Medical Sciences, Al Janad University for Science and Technology, Taiz, Yemen
7. Department of Pharmacy, Faculty of Medical Sciences, Al Janad University for Science and Technology, Taiz, Yemen